Output e18c95331c6dbd5de0592a0548c5f83c8dcd6883e9063200768291c4e3f79b9e:0

value
4564996
script pubkey
OP_0 OP_PUSHBYTES_20 36e14849b4de97dd4f484aae12ca09f85d5fb8e9
address
bc1qxms5sjd5m6ta6n6gf2hp9jsflpw4lw8fxkt55n
transaction
e18c95331c6dbd5de0592a0548c5f83c8dcd6883e9063200768291c4e3f79b9e
confirmations
21229
spent
false